Meanwhile, in the United Kingdom, a significant cliff fall near Peacehaven in East Sussex has raised concerns. The local council has issued warnings to residents and visitors to stay away from the cliff edges and bases due to the unstable nature of the chalk cliffs. This incident highlights the natural changes and challenges that can occur during the autumn season.

In the United States, the phenomenon of “false autumn” has been observed due to extreme weather conditions. Experts explain that the heatwave and drought have caused trees to enter survival mode, leading to early leaf drop and color changes. This unusual occurrence serves as a reminder of the impact of climate change on our environment.

Autumn is also a time for cultural and traditional celebrations. In India, the festival of Navratri is celebrated with great enthusiasm during this season. People participate in Garba and Dandiya Raas dances, wear colorful traditional attire, and enjoy delicious festive foods. This nine-day festival is dedicated to the worship of the goddess Durga and symbolizes the victory of good over evil.

In Japan, the autumn season is marked by the celebration of Tsukimi, or the Moon Viewing Festival. Families gather to admire the full moon, enjoy traditional foods like dango (rice dumplings), and appreciate the beauty of the autumn night sky. This festival reflects the deep connection between nature and culture in Japanese society.
